Who were the Anglo-Saxons

2 Answers

3 votes
"The Anglo-Saxons are a people who have inhabited Great Britain from the 5th century. They comprise people from Germanic tribes who migrated to the island from continental Europe, their descendants, and indigenousBritish groups who adopted some aspects of Anglo-Saxon culture and language."
